A global enterprise SaaS business is hiring a Chief Product & Technology Officer to help lead a major transformation across product, engineering and AI strategy. The company operates an established international B2B software platform with approximately 450 employees globally, around £50m ARR and an 83% recurring SaaS revenue model. Following a broader strategic shift, the business is investing heavily into the future of its modern Finance ERP platform and next-generation AI capabilities. This is not a traditional CTO role.
The business is specifically looking for a product-led technology executive who can combine platform strategy, engineering leadership and commercial thinking within a complex enterprise software environment. The role sits directly alongside the CEO and will play a central role in shaping the future direction of the platform, product organization and broader technology strategy.
What you will be leading:
- The company is moving away from a fragmented legacy product estate toward a more unified, AI-enabled finance platform architecture.
- Key challenges include modernizing mature enterprise software environments, simplifying and rationalizing product architecture, embedding AI meaningfully into workflows and customer outcomes, improving execution velocity across product and engineering, aligning platform strategy more closely to commercial growth.
This environment combines enterprise SaaS scale with the pace and ambiguity of a transformation-led business. The role requires someone comfortable making difficult prioritization decisions, driving organizational change and balancing innovation with operational realities.
